About C1119 River
This lovely girl, aptly named as she was rescued from a river, has had a rough start in life. Understandably, when she first came into care she was incredibly frightened and overwhelmed but it has been extremely rewarding to see her quickly respond to a loving environment with her foster carer. She now is cuddle and smooch obsessed and loves a good headbutt.
River’s photos do not do her justice. She is a very striking cat with incredibly soft fur. We think this little girl was going to be black but maybe the ink was running low, resulting in very attractive and distinctive colouring.
She is so deserving of a loving furever home, and will respond accordingly.
